I tracked some drums recently, and the cymbals came out really 'wishy washy' for lack of a better term. Not sure how to explain it, but it's basically the sound changing from the cymbal rocking back and forth on it's stand. I soloed one mic, and it's still there, so it's not phase, and I tried various levels of compression, expansion and a few other things to see if it would help, but to no avail. The (OH) mics were placed about 6 feet in front of the kit at about tom level (XY stereo). I tried coming in from over the kit, and it helps it a bit, but then I'm not getting enough tom in the OH. Any suggestions?

9 times out of 10 it's an issue of mic placement. Look at how the cymbals are mounted in the kit. Place your micpoint at the area where the cymbals wobble the least when struck. You can do quite superior close micing without getting a wishy uneven sound. When those cymbal mics get too high they cease to be cymbal mics and start to become room mics. You will want to keep the over heads equidistant from the snare to maintain a good punchy center. Here's a link to a Massenburg setup - http://www.massenburg.com/cgi-bin/ml/tracking_mics.html

If you're hearing this while you solo one overhead mic... it's being caused by early high frequency reflections.

My guess is that the recording space for your drum kit is small with low ceilings and there is little to no acoustic treatment.

Am I right?

If you can't find satisfactory mic placement or record in a bigger room... then high frequency diffusion will fix this.

moonbaby wrote: This problem is aggravated by mic placement too close to the edge of the cymbals.As the cymbal sways, Doppler comes into play bigtime, and what you hear is that. The mic simply needs to be re-positioned so that it isn't as sensitive to that "moving target" edge.

Moving the overheads higher to let the cymbals breathe works, but it can also make the drums sound more distant... which may not be the sound you're after. Another approach is to place the overheads over the bell of the crash cymbals to avoid picking up the effects of cymbal movement, but you have then shifted from mic-ing the kit to mic-ing the cymbals. That's fine if your close mics will take care of the drums, but it's a very 70's sound, and compared to today's releases... it can sound a little too tight and generally not big enough.

If you are counting on your overheads for the bulk of your drum sound, and you want that big and fat but very close and present drum kit sound, then high or wide overhead mike placement, or "cymbal mic-ing" may not be a good solution.

I agree with Moonbaby. Try EVERY mic placement you can to find the sound you're looking for with out the wishy-washy cymbals. Might help to have an assistant move the mics for you while you listen. The right positions are probably in there somewhere... but if it still aludes you... it's probably coming from high frequency reflections and you'll need to fix the room... not the mix.

If you have enough mics and enough channels in your front-end, ambient mics in front of the kit can help fill in the sound of the kit and help eliminate your cymbal problem.

This usually happens in a small room. Very common cybal bounces off of the wall right back into the mics and you basically hear the cymbal again and again in the mic. If you have a small room you will need some treatment.

Also ask the drummer not to hit the cymbals so hard and not all the time.

In a small room dead ceiling, semi dead walls and over heads as high as possible XY works pretty good. Make the drummer go easy on the cymbals. experienced drummers usually understand recording and their surroundings and consequently their recordings sound better.
